Ultrasonic Humidifier
Ultrasonic humidifiers are favored for their ability to generate a fine mist using high-frequency vibrations. These devices are particularly suitable for environments requiring quiet operation, such as hospitals and offices, where noise can be disruptive. When sourcing ultrasonic humidifiers, B2B buyers should consider factors like tank capacity, mist output levels, and maintenance requirements, as regular cleaning is essential to prevent mold and bacteria growth.
Evaporative Humidifier
Evaporative humidifiers utilize a fan to draw air through a wet wick, allowing moisture to evaporate into the air. They are ideal for larger spaces, such as retail environments or schools, where cost-effectiveness and self-regulating humidity levels are paramount. Buyers should assess the wick replacement frequency and the unit’s coverage area, as efficiency can vary significantly based on room size and airflow.
Steam Vaporizers
Steam vaporizers heat water to create steam, which is then cooled before being released into the air. These devices are effective for sterilizing the air, making them suitable for medical facilities and wellness centers. B2B purchasers must consider the energy consumption and safety features, particularly in environments with children or patients, as the high temperatures can pose risks if not managed properly.
Hybrid Humidifiers
Hybrid humidifiers combine the benefits of ultrasonic and evaporative technologies, providing versatility in humidity control. They are suitable for high-end residential and corporate environments where customized settings and aesthetics are critical. Buyers should be prepared for a higher initial investment and evaluate the unit’s adaptability to different humidity levels and user preferences, ensuring that it meets specific operational needs.
Portable Bottle Humidifier
Portable bottle humidifiers are designed for convenience, often powered via USB, making them ideal for travel or small office spaces. Their compact size allows for easy transport, catering to individuals who need moisture on the go. While they are user-friendly and require minimal setup, B2B buyers should consider their limited capacity and coverage area, which may not suffice for larger rooms or extended use.

1. Polypropylene (PP)
Key Properties: Polypropylene is a thermoplastic polymer known for its excellent chemical resistance, low density, and ability to withstand temperatures up to 100°C. It is also lightweight and has good impact resistance.
Pros & Cons: The primary advantage of polypropylene is its cost-effectiveness and durability, making it suitable for mass production. However, it has a relatively low temperature resistance compared to other materials, which may limit its application in high-temperature environments. Additionally, while it is generally resistant to many chemicals, it can be susceptible to UV degradation if not treated.
Impact on Application: Polypropylene is compatible with a wide range of liquids, making it ideal for humidifiers that require regular water refills. However, its limitations in high-temperature scenarios could restrict its use in certain applications.
Considerations for International Buyers: Buyers should ensure that the polypropylene used complies with local food safety standards, such as FDA regulations in the U.S. or EU regulations in Europe. It is also essential to verify the material’s UV resistance, especially for humidifiers intended for outdoor use in regions with high sun exposure.
2. Stainless Steel
Key Properties: Stainless steel is renowned for its superior strength, corrosion resistance, and ability to withstand high temperatures and pressures. Common grades include 304 and 316, with 316 offering enhanced corrosion resistance due to its molybdenum content.
Pros & Cons: The durability and aesthetic appeal of stainless steel make it a popular choice for premium humidifiers. However, it is generally more expensive than plastic alternatives, and its manufacturing process can be complex, requiring specialized equipment.
Impact on Application: Stainless steel is highly compatible with water and various humidifying agents, making it suitable for long-term use in humidifiers. Its resistance to corrosion ensures longevity, particularly in humid environments.
Considerations for International Buyers: Buyers should look for compliance with international standards such as ASTM and DIN for material quality. In regions like the Middle East, where humidity levels are high, opting for higher-grade stainless steel (like 316) may be advisable to prevent corrosion.
3. Silicone
Key Properties: Silicone is a flexible, rubber-like material that can withstand extreme temperatures (from -60°C to 200°C) and is highly resistant to water and chemicals. Its flexibility allows for easy manipulation and design variations.
Pros & Cons: The primary advantage of silicone is its versatility and ability to maintain performance across a wide temperature range. However, it may have a higher initial cost compared to other materials, and its long-term durability can vary based on the specific formulation used.
Impact on Application: Silicone is particularly effective in applications requiring flexibility and resilience, making it ideal for humidifiers that need to be portable or compact. Its compatibility with various liquids enhances its utility in humidifying applications.
Considerations for International Buyers: Buyers should ensure that the silicone meets relevant health and safety standards, particularly in the food and beverage industry. Compliance with certifications such as FDA or EU food contact regulations is crucial, especially for humidifiers used in sensitive environments like hospitals or schools.
4. Glass
Key Properties: Glass is non-reactive, impermeable, and can withstand high temperatures, making it an excellent choice for applications requiring purity and safety. It is also aesthetically pleasing and provides a premium feel.
Pros & Cons: The main advantage of glass is its inert nature, which ensures that it does not leach chemicals into the water. However, it is heavier and more fragile than other materials, which can complicate transportation and handling.
Impact on Application: Glass is suitable for high-end humidifiers where purity and aesthetics are paramount. Its ability to maintain water quality makes it ideal for applications in health and wellness sectors.
Considerations for International Buyers: Buyers should consider the fragility of glass when shipping and handling, particularly in regions prone to rough transportation conditions. Compliance with safety standards is also essential, as broken glass can pose hazards.

In-depth Look: Manufacturing Processes and Quality Assurance for water bottle humidifier
Manufacturing Processes for Water Bottle Humidifiers
The manufacturing process of water bottle humidifiers involves several critical stages, each requiring meticulous attention to detail to ensure high-quality output. Understanding these stages can help B2B buyers make informed procurement decisions.
1. Material Preparation
The first step in manufacturing water bottle humidifiers is material preparation. Common materials include high-grade plastics (like BPA-free polyethylene or polypropylene), silicone, and sometimes glass for specific components. The choice of material directly impacts the durability, safety, and functionality of the humidifier.
- Material Sourcing: Suppliers should be vetted for compliance with international safety standards. B2B buyers should ensure materials are sourced from reputable suppliers who provide material safety data sheets (MSDS) to confirm the absence of harmful substances.
- Pre-processing: This may involve cutting, molding, or treating the materials to enhance properties like heat resistance or flexibility. Buyers should inquire about the methods used to ensure materials are prepared to the specifications required for humidifier functionality.
2. Forming
The forming stage is crucial as it shapes the prepared materials into the components of the humidifier. This typically involves techniques such as:
- Injection Molding: This is the most common method for creating plastic parts. It allows for precise control over the shape and size of components, ensuring consistency across production batches.
- Blow Molding: Used for creating hollow components like the water reservoir, blow molding ensures that the walls are uniform and free from defects.
- Thermoforming: For certain designs, sheets of plastic are heated and formed over molds to create specific shapes.
B2B buyers should evaluate a supplier’s capabilities in these forming techniques, as this directly correlates with the quality and performance of the final product.
3. Assembly
Once individual components are formed, they undergo assembly. This stage may involve:
- Manual Assembly: Some parts may require hand assembly, especially for intricate components or when adding features like LED indicators.
- Automated Assembly Lines: For larger production volumes, automated processes can enhance efficiency and reduce labor costs. This includes robotic arms for precision assembly.
Buyers should consider the assembly process’s scalability and flexibility, particularly if they require customizations or adjustments to standard models.
4. Finishing
The finishing stage includes processes that enhance the product’s aesthetics and functionality:
- Surface Treatment: This may involve polishing, coating, or applying finishes that improve the product’s look and feel, as well as its resistance to wear and tear.
- Quality Testing: After assembly, each unit may undergo rigorous testing to ensure it meets specified performance criteria, such as mist output and water capacity.
B2B buyers should inquire about the finishing techniques used and how they contribute to the product’s overall quality.

Quality Control Checkpoints
To maintain high standards, several quality control checkpoints are integrated into the manufacturing process:
- Incoming Quality Control (IQC): This initial checkpoint involves inspecting raw materials upon arrival. It ensures that all materials meet predefined specifications before they enter the production line.
- In-Process Quality Control (IPQC): During manufacturing, IPQC involves monitoring and inspecting processes to detect defects early. This may include visual inspections and functional tests at various stages.
- Final Quality Control (FQC): Before products are packaged and shipped, FQC ensures that each unit meets the final quality standards. This includes performance testing and aesthetic inspections.
Common Testing Methods
- Performance Testing: Humidifiers are tested for mist output, water capacity, and operational efficiency. This ensures that they perform as intended in real-world scenarios.
- Durability Testing: Products are subjected to stress tests to assess their resistance to wear and tear over time.
- Safety Testing: Compliance with safety standards, such as electrical safety for models with power components, is verified through rigorous testing.

Essential Technical Properties and Trade Terminology for water bottle humidifier
Key Technical Properties of Water Bottle Humidifiers
When sourcing water bottle humidifiers, understanding the technical specifications is crucial for ensuring product quality and suitability for your market. Here are several critical properties that B2B buyers should consider:
-
Material Grade
– Definition: This refers to the type and quality of materials used in the humidifier’s construction, such as BPA-free plastic, silicone, or glass.
– Importance: High-grade materials enhance durability and safety, which is essential for consumer trust, especially in markets with stringent health regulations. For instance, using BPA-free plastic can be a selling point in regions like Europe, where consumer awareness about chemical safety is heightened. -
Water Capacity
– Definition: This is the maximum amount of water the humidifier can hold, typically measured in milliliters (ml).
– Importance: Understanding water capacity helps in determining the operational duration of the humidifier. Larger capacities are beneficial for commercial applications, such as in hotels or offices, where continuous operation is necessary without frequent refilling. -
Power Consumption
– Definition: This indicates the amount of energy the humidifier uses during operation, usually expressed in watts (W).
– Importance: For B2B buyers, especially in regions with high electricity costs, low power consumption models can lead to significant cost savings over time. Additionally, energy-efficient products can enhance a company’s sustainability credentials. -
Mist Output Rate
– Definition: This refers to the volume of mist the humidifier can produce, often measured in milliliters per hour (ml/h).
– Importance: A higher mist output rate is crucial for effectively increasing humidity in larger spaces. For buyers targeting industrial or commercial applications, this specification can directly impact user satisfaction and product effectiveness. -
Noise Level
– Definition: This measures the operational sound produced by the humidifier, typically quantified in decibels (dB).
– Importance: Noise levels are particularly important in settings like offices, hospitals, or bedrooms, where a quiet environment is essential. Buyers should seek models that operate at low noise levels to enhance user comfort. -
Filter Type and Maintenance
– Definition: This specifies the type of filter used (if any) in the humidifier and its maintenance requirements.
– Importance: Regular maintenance is vital for optimal performance and longevity. Understanding the filter type helps buyers plan for replacement schedules and costs, ensuring that the humidifier operates efficiently over time.
